		<description>@Graegos: NO, do not use preload in a web setup.  With web servers, the goal is to NEVER load or swap -- try to keep everything you need in memory.  If you MUST call some external application regularly, then preload may help a little, but if you need it a lot, you&#039;ve almost certainly mis-configured or mis-specified your server.</description>
